WebLive streaming is a shopping mode where live streamers, often times KOLs, broadcast in real time with products they are selling. Viewers can then immediately purchase that item from an embedded link. WebJan 15, 2024 · The prominence of live streaming in China demonstrates technology’s role in day-to-day life. Video streaming has found its way into markets as distinct as agriculture, dating, and online gaming. In this blog, we take a look at how this trend is impacting business models and consumer behavior alike.
